Intel may have been lacking behind One Laptop Per Child (OLPC) for some time now, but this deal with the Portuguese government means that half a million Classmates will be sent to schools around the country. This puts Intel’s laptop just 100,000 sales behind OLPC. The Portuguese government say that ”by equipping our schools with state-of-the-art computing technology and Internet connectivity, we hope to hasten the transition to economic models that benefit our citizens.”
